Job Summary
Serving as a strategic communications advisor, the full-time salaried Oncology Communications Director will manage brand communications strategies, oversee media relations, and enhance the company's reputation through integrated communications focused on oncology initiatives, all while working remotely.
Key Responsibilities
- Provide communications counsel to senior leaders across various teams within the oncology business
- Develop and lead external communications strategies for oncology commercial indications and pipeline, including key messaging and campaign materials
- Manage media relations strategies to strengthen the company's corporate reputation and prepare executives for media engagements
Required Qualifications
- Bachelor's degree in Communications, PR, Journalism, Life Sciences, or related field; advanced degree preferred
- 10-12 years of experience in corporate communications or public relations, preferably in the pharmaceutical or biotech industry, with oncology experience strongly preferred
- Proven ability to develop and implement strategic communications plans in a complex, global environment
- Strong project management skills with the ability to prioritize and multitask effectively
- Experience managing external agencies and budgets
